FerroSorb is a proprietary sorption material for iron and manganese removal
FerroSorb bead
  • Ferrosorb ensures total iron and manganese removal
    Iron is removed in the following way: ADSORPTION — OXIDATION — ACTIVE LAYER FORMATION — AUTOCATALYTIC OXIDATION. Due to this process FerroSorb removes most common species of iron in raw water: ferrous, ferric, organic, and colloidal. Active layer of Ferrosorb contains active sites for manganese removal.
  • Proven alternative to aeration and chlorination
    Ecomix shows best performance when raw water is fed directly to Ecomix unit. Do not use oxidative pre-treatment before the Ecomix system.

  • Regenerated as a softener
    Ecomix is regenerated using the same sequence as a common softener: backwash, brine, rinse, fill. Calcium and magnesium ions are displaced from the cation exchange resin matrix with sodium ions. Humisorb is regenerated with chloride ions.
  • Iron and manganese are purged
    by surface scour mechanism
    Iron and manganese are removed during backwash by surface scour mechanism in fluidized bed.

removing Natural organic matter

HumiSorb is a proprietary sorption material
for removal of natural organic matter
(reducing color and NOM)
Organic compounds are removed by the mechanism of hydrophobic and electrostatic interactions
